I'd try to get some big $$ things out of the way. The smaller things are easier to save up for. How wide are your rims? If they are 7" you can't fit a 245 on there good(or at all probably). Stick with 225s. FMIC is a good upgrade and you can get the GReddy for $885 shipped.
